A microgram ($\mu$g or mcg) is a unit of mass in the International System of Units (SI) equal to one-millionth of a gram. A milligram (mg) is a unit of mass equal to one-thousandth of a gram. Because both units are derived from the gram, they maintain a fixed decimal relationship. The conversion from micrograms to milligrams is based on the metric prefix system, where "micro" denotes $10^{-6}$ and "milli" denotes $10^{-3}$. In practical usage, this tool performs a division operation by 1,000. When I validated the results through repeated testing, I found that the tool consistently shifts the decimal point three places to the left, which is the mathematical requirement for moving from a smaller unit to a larger one.
The following formula is used by the Micrograms to Milligrams Converter to generate results:
\text{Milligrams (mg)} = \frac{\text{Micrograms (\mu g)}}{1000} \\ \text{mg} = \mu g \times 0.001
The relationship between micrograms and milligrams is linear. One milligram is exactly equal to 1,000 micrograms. This means that for every 1,000 units added to the microgram input, the milligram output increases by 1. The following table demonstrates common conversion points observed during tool testing:
| Micrograms ($\mu$g) | Milligrams (mg) |
|---|---|
| 1 $\mu$g | 0.001 mg |
| 10 $\mu$g | 0.01 mg |
| 100 $\mu$g | 0.1 mg |
| 500 $\mu$g | 0.5 mg |
| 1,000 $\mu$g | 1 mg |
| 5,000 $\mu$g | 5 mg |
| 10,000 $\mu$g | 10 mg |
To illustrate how the tool processes data, consider the following examples based on real-world inputs:
Example 1: Converting a small dosage
If a user enters 250 micrograms into the tool:
\frac{250 \mu g}{1000} = 0.25 \text{ mg}
Example 2: Converting a larger quantity
If a user enters 15,750 micrograms:
\frac{15750 \mu g}{1000} = 15.75 \text{ mg}
Example 3: Converting a sub-unit
If a user enters 0.5 micrograms:
\frac{0.5 \mu g}{1000} = 0.0005 \text{ mg}

This is where most users make mistakes: misidentifying the direction of the conversion. It is common to accidentally multiply by 1,000 instead of dividing when attempting to convert from a smaller unit to a larger one. Based on repeated tests, I have observed that users often lose track of "leading zeros" when performing this calculation manually.
